A MySQL TutorialThis part will help you familiarize yourself with MySQL by providing a tutorial for you to try. As you work through it, you will create a sample database and some tables, and then interact with the database by adding, retrieving, deleting, and modifying information in the tables. During the process of working with the sample database, you will learn the following things:
• The basics of the SQL language that MySQL understands. (If you already know SQL from having used some other RDBMS, it would be a good idea to skim through this tutorial to see whether MySQL's version of SQL differs from the version with which you are familiar.)
• How to communicate with a MySQL server using a few of the standard MySQL client programs. As noted in the previous section, MySQL operates using a client/server architecture in which the server runs on the machine containing the databases and clients connect to the server over a network. This tutorial is based largely on the mysql client program, which reads SQL queries from you, sends them to the server to be executed, and displays the results so that you can see what happened. mysql runs on all platforms supported by MySQL and provides the most direct means of interacting with the server, so it's the logical client to begin with.

Design is the process by which products are created and modified. For many years designers sought ways to describe and analyze three-dimensional designs without building physical models. Although orthographic projections can be used to provide much of the information, they still require designers to translate between the three-dimensional object and flat two-dimensional views. With the advancements in computer technology, the creation of three-dimensional models on computers offers a wide range of benefits. Computer models are easier to interpret and can be altered easily. Computer models can be analyzed using finite element analysis software, and simulation of real-life loads can be applied to the computer models and the results graphically displayed.
There are three basic types of three-dimensional computer geometric modeling methods: wireframe modeling, surface modeling and solid modeling. The 3-D wireframe models contain information about the locations of all the points and edges in space coordinates. The 3-D models can be viewed from any direction as needed and are reasonably good representations of 3-D objects. But because surface definition is not part of a wireframe model, all wireframe images have the inherent problem of ambiguity.

First off, what is a static mesh? In Unreal Ed, a static mesh is a piece of geometry that does not have any animations. This is not to say it won’t move in game. A few examples of static meshes would be the decorative piping you see running along walls or ceilings, a tree stump, or even an elevator lift that moves once you step on it. In the case of the elevator lift, it is animated using Matinee, Unreal’s key frame animation system, not an external 3D package such as Max or Maya. I have done this and if you lookThinkPad 600/600E (2645) Hardware Maintenance ManualHow to Use Error Messages: Use the error codes displayed on the screen to diagnose failures. If more than one error code is displayed, begin the diagnosis with the first error code. The cause of the first error code can result in false error codes being displayed. If no error code is displayed, see if the error symptom is listed in the Symptom-to-FRU Index for the computer you are servicing.

If you have CD-ROM based applications installed (those that require the CD-ROM to run), these applications may be expecting to find your CD-ROM drive at D:, which may have changed.
If you have problems running these applications, verify the drive letter of your CD-ROM, and reinstall the CD-ROM applications if the CD-ROM drive is at a new drive letter. Remember, perform this step of making partitions and formatting them only if you didn’t use EasyMove in Step 1, above.
